SpreadCo vs DF Markets - Headquarters And Year Of Founding
SpreadCo was founded in 2005 and has its headquaters in London.
DF Markets was founded in 2010 and has its head office in UK.

SpreadCo vs DF Markets - Regulation And Licencing In More Detail
SpreadCo is regulated by Financial Conduct Authority (FCA).
DF Markets is regulated by Financial Conduct Authority (FCA).

Compare SpreadCo vs DF Markets Commission And Fees
SpreadCo and DF Markets are online broker platforms, and many online brokerages charge lower prices than traditional brokerages tend to charge. The cause of this is that the businesses of online trading platforms are scaled better. That is, an online broker isn't necessarily affected by the amount of clients they have.
However, this does not necessarily mean that online brokers do not charge any fees. They charge prices of varying rates for various services to earn money. There are mainly 3 types of penalties for this purpose.
The first kind of fees to look out for are trading charges. Whenever you make a genuine trade, like purchasing a stock or an ETF, you are charged trading fees. In these instances, you're paying a spread, financing rate, or even a commission. The sorts of trading charges and the rates vary from broker to broker.
Commissions could be fixed or dependent on the traded volume. On the flip side, a spread denotes the gap between the buying and selling cost. Funding or overnight rates are people that are billed when you maintain a leveraged position for more than a day.
Apart from trading charges, online agents also bill non-trading fees. These are dependent on the actions you undertake in your accounts. They are charged for operations like depositing cash, not trading for lengthy periods, or withdrawals.
